什么时用 h2数据库连接
-
H2数据库是一个嵌入式数据库,适用于在Java应用程序中使用。以下是一些使用H2数据库连接的常见情况:
-
开发和测试环境:H2数据库非常适合在开发和测试环境中使用。由于其轻量级和易于部署的特点,可以快速启动和关闭数据库,方便开发人员进行本地开发和单元测试。
-
原型开发:使用H2数据库可以快速创建原型和演示应用程序。它提供了简单的配置和易于使用的API,使得开发人员能够快速迭代和验证他们的想法。
-
小型项目:对于小型项目或个人项目,H2数据库是一个理想的选择。它不需要复杂的服务器配置和管理,可以直接在应用程序中使用,省去了额外的安装和配置步骤。
-
数据分析和报告:H2数据库提供了一些内置的分析和报告功能,使其成为处理和分析大量数据的强大工具。它支持常见的SQL查询和聚合函数,可以轻松地对数据进行统计和可视化。
-
教育和培训:由于H2数据库的简单性和易用性,它经常被用于教育和培训目的。学生和初学者可以快速上手,学习数据库的基本概念和SQL语言。
总而言之,H2数据库适用于小型项目、原型开发、教育和培训以及需要快速部署和测试的场景。它提供了简单的API和内置的分析功能,方便开发人员进行数据处理和报告。
1年前 -
-
H2数据库是一种轻量级的嵌入式数据库,通常用于开发和测试环境,适用于小型应用程序或者需要快速启动和测试的项目。以下是一些适合使用H2数据库的情况:
-
开发和测试环境:H2数据库非常适合在开发和测试环境中使用。它可以轻松地嵌入到应用程序中,不需要额外的安装和配置,而且启动速度非常快。这使得开发人员可以快速迭代和测试他们的应用程序。
-
单用户应用程序:如果你正在开发一个单用户的应用程序,例如个人博客、待办事项列表或者小型管理系统,H2数据库是一个很好的选择。它可以轻松地嵌入到应用程序中,不需要额外的服务器和管理。
-
小型项目:对于小型项目来说,H2数据库是一个很好的选择。它具有较小的内存占用和磁盘空间占用,适合处理小规模的数据集。
-
数据分析和报告:H2数据库提供了一些内置的函数和工具,用于数据分析和报告。你可以使用SQL查询来处理和分析数据,并使用内置的图表和报表功能来可视化结果。
-
临时和临时数据存储:如果你需要在应用程序中存储临时数据或者缓存数据,H2数据库是一个很好的选择。它可以在内存中存储数据,提供快速的读写性能。
总之,H2数据库适用于小型应用程序、开发和测试环境、单用户应用程序以及需要快速启动和测试的项目。它是一个轻量级、嵌入式的数据库,提供了方便的使用和快速的启动速度。
1年前 -
-
H2数据库是一个嵌入式内存数据库,它可以用于构建轻量级的Java应用程序。它被广泛应用于测试、原型开发和小型应用程序中。下面是使用H2数据库建立连接的一般步骤:
-
引入H2数据库依赖
首先,在项目的构建文件(如pom.xml)中添加H2数据库的依赖项。如果是Maven项目,可以在标签中添加以下依赖项: <dependency> <groupId>com.h2database</groupId> <artifactId>h2</artifactId> <version>1.4.200</version> </dependency> -
创建数据库连接
在Java代码中,可以使用JDBC API来创建和管理H2数据库连接。首先需要加载数据库驱动程序,然后使用数据库连接字符串、用户名和密码来创建连接。下面是一个使用H2数据库连接的示例代码:import java.sql.Connection; import java.sql.DriverManager; import java.sql.SQLException; public class H2ConnectionExample { public static void main(String[] args) { Connection connection = null; try { // 加载驱动程序 Class.forName("org.h2.Driver"); // 创建连接 String url = "jdbc:h2:~/test"; String username = "sa"; String password = ""; connection = DriverManager.getConnection(url, username, password); // 进行数据库操作 // ... } catch (ClassNotFoundException e) { e.printStackTrace(); } catch (SQLException e) { e.printStackTrace(); } finally { // 关闭连接 if (connection != null) { try { connection.close(); } catch (SQLException e) { e.printStackTrace(); } } } } }在上面的代码中,首先加载H2数据库的驱动程序(org.h2.Driver),然后创建一个连接字符串(jdbc:h2:~/test),这将在用户的home目录下创建一个名为test的数据库。接下来,使用用户名(sa)和密码(空字符串)来建立数据库连接。最后,可以在注释部分进行数据库操作。
-
执行数据库操作
一旦成功建立了数据库连接,就可以使用JDBC API来执行各种数据库操作,例如创建表、插入数据、查询数据等。具体的操作取决于应用程序的需求。
总结:
使用H2数据库连接的步骤包括引入H2数据库依赖、创建数据库连接和执行数据库操作。首先需要在项目中引入H2数据库的依赖项,然后使用JDBC API来创建和管理数据库连接。一旦成功建立了连接,就可以使用JDBC API来执行各种数据库操作。1年前 -